Added missing #include <ArduinoJson/Namespace.hpp>

This commit is contained in:
Benoit Blanchon
2019-09-13 12:09:02 +02:00
parent 140525b7a0
commit 2078871f36
36 changed files with 67 additions and 2 deletions

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<stddef.h> // size_t
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#if ARDUINOJSON_ENABLE_ARDUINO_STREAM
#include <Stream.h>

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
template <typename T>

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#if ARDUINOJSON_ENABLE_STD_STREAM
#include <ostream>
#endif

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#if ARDUINOJSON_ENABLE_PROGMEM
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
template <typename TIterator>

View File

@ -4,7 +4,7 @@
#pragma once
#include <ArduinoJson/Configuration.hpp>
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#if ARDUINOJSON_ENABLE_STD_STREAM
#include <istream>

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
class EscapeSequence {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
namespace Utf8 {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<stddef.h> // size_t
namespace ARDUINOJSON_NAMESPACE {

View File

@ -6,7 +6,7 @@
#include <stddef.h> // for size_t
#include <ArduinoJson/Configuration.hpp>
#include <ArduinoJson/Namespace.hpp>
#define JSON_STRING_SIZE(SIZE) (SIZE)

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
inline void doubleToFloat(const uint8_t d[8], uint8_t f[4]) {

View File

@ -5,6 +5,7 @@
#pragma once
#include <ArduinoJson/Configuration.hpp>
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{

View File

@ -5,6 +5,7 @@
#pragma once
#include <ArduinoJson/Configuration.hpp>
#include <ArduinoJson/Namespace.hpp>
#include <stdint.h> // int64_t

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
inline bool isdigit(char c) {

View File

@ -4,6 +4,7 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<ArduinoJson/Polyfills/assert.hpp>
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// Some libraries #define isnan() and isinf() so we need to check before

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<stddef.h> // for size_t
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// Wraps a const char* so that the our functions are picked only if the
// originals are missing

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
inline int8_t safe_strcmp(const char* a, const char* b) {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
template <bool Condition, class TrueType, class FalseType>

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// A meta-function that return the type T if Condition is true.

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
template <typename T, T v>

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<stddef.h> // size_t
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// A meta-function that returns true if Derived inherits from TBase is an

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// A meta-function that return the type T without the const modifier

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// A meta-function that return the type T without the reference modifier.

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
template <typename T>
inline void swap(T& a, T& b) {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
class DummyWriter {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
// A Print implementation that allows to write in a char[]

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
class StringMover {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
class SizedFlashStringAdapter {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<string.h> // strcmp
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
#include <string>
namespace ARDUINOJSON_NAMESPACE {

View File

@ -4,6 +4,8 @@
#pragma once
#include <ArduinoJson/Namespace.hpp>
namespace ARDUINOJSON_NAMESPACE {
class ArrayRef;
class ObjectRef;